Fortunately for us, the force within us (God) is greater. I imagine we’re all familiar with gates and the purpose of a gate.



It's basically to keep something in; not just keep it in but keep it secure so that it does not escape or get stolen; that is the essence of gates. If you remember, last week, I mentioned that Christianity is about warfare and not bread and butter or a plate of salad. As children of God, the gates of hell will forever try to prevail against us. To enlighten myself, I looked up the word prevail and it means to be or prove superior in strength, power or influence, to be dominant. So basically what our verse is telling us is that there is a contention between us, the children of God, and the enemy and God through His son Jesus have assured us that we shall be the dominant force. Remember that from the days of John the Baptist, the kingdom of Heaven suffereth violence (Matt. 11:12).
